Recital:  Invitation to the Dance

About

Saturday 12th October at 7pm – Invitation to the Dance
A one-man recital, presented from the piano by Kenneth Roberts.

Since time immemorial, the dance has proved one of the most powerful influences on musicians. Kennith Roberts will play and talk about some of the great piano music inspired by, and composed for, the dance in a whole variety of moods and styles.

Includes music by Weber, Grieg, Debussy, Granados, Albeniz Scott Joplin and others
